Customer service

Amazon is known for its customer support, but it is not always available when you need it the most. This is particularly relevant if you're a seller who uses Fulfillment by Amazon or Seller Fulfilled Prime. FBA is an eCommerce fulfilment programme that allows retailers to send their merchandise to an Amazon warehouse, which handles the warehousing, packing, picking and fulfillment on their behalf. SFP is similar, however, it enables sellers to retain control over their own fulfillment operations, while also benefiting from benefits such as access to Prime shipping.
